SAN DIEGO GAS & CAR WASH

San Diego Gas & Car Wash

San Diego Gas & Car Wash3861 Valley Centre Dr, San Diego, CA 92130, United States+18587929009https://sandiegogasandcarwash.com/Express Car Wash San DiegoUnveiling Excellence: Car Wash and Oil Lube Products and services in San DiegoIn the vibrant coastal metropolis of San Diego, wherever sunshine and sea breezes will be the norm, your motor vehicle

read more